- Independent review flagged two important adjustments:
|
|
- keep `DEFAULT_DATABASE_URL` on `5433` because local Docker Compose maps host `5433 -> container 5432`
|
|
- prefer Turbo `env` over `passThroughEnv` so DB config changes also affect the test cache key
